- TreVeyon Henderson practiced Friday without a red non-contact jersey and was designated questionable for Week 17 against the Jets.
- Head coach Mike Vrabel said the rookie remains in the concussion protocol, declining to specify his stage in the process.
- Henderson exited last week’s win over the Ravens with a concussion and leads the team with 776 rushing yards on 5.2 yards per carry.
- Defensive tackle Milton Williams will not be activated from injured reserve, with New England noting a recent dip to six sacks over four games and 570 rushing yards allowed at 4.8 per carry.
- Six other starters were ruled out for Sunday — Robert Spillane, Harold Landry, Khyiris Tonga, Jared Wilson, Kayshon Boutte, and Mack Hollins — while DeMario Douglas is questionable, as the Patriots pursue seeding goals after clinching a playoff spot.
